Cancellation of requirement to obtain proof of credit card use abroad for customers who communicated with the bank

The Central Bank cancels the requirement for banks to obtain proof of departure and arrival stamps from traveling customers who communicated with the bank to use their credit cards abroad. This exemption applies specifically to the obligation outlined in item No. 2 of the periodic book dated October 29, 2023. Banks retain the right to monitor credit card usage to verify it occurred while the customer was abroad. If a customer fails to submit documents proving such usage, the issuing bank must take the procedures stipulated in item No. 3 of the October 29, 2023 circular and adhere to the February 11, 2024 circular.

Cairo, August 12, 2025

Mr. Professor/ Chairman of the Board of Directors

Bank

Greetings,

With reference to the periodic book issued on October 29, 2023, and amended on February 11, 2024, regarding strengthening

The control over the use of credit cards abroad, where some regulatory rules were determined in this regard, as well as

The procedures that must be taken in case of non-compliance with it.

In light of the Central Bank's follow-up of developments in this regard, it has been decided - for traveling customers who have

Communicated with the bank to use their cards abroad - cancel what is stated in item No. 2 of the periodic book dated

October 29, 2023, which states: "Follow up with the customer to obtain proof that the card was used while they were abroad,

This is done through departure and arrival stamps within a maximum period of 90 days from the date of opening usage limits, or whatever proves

The customer's continued presence abroad if the specified period is exceeded."

The bank has the right to follow up on customers’ use of credit cards to ensure that they were used while they were abroad, and in case of

The customer's failure to submit documents indicating this, the bank issuing the card must take the procedures stipulated in the item

No. (3) of the periodic book dated October 29, 2023, as well as adherence to what is stated in the periodic book issued on

February 11, 2024, referred to above.

Please kindly direct towards commitment to what is stated above.
